-
1.
Outer; located towards the outside.
-
2.
Visible, noticeable.
By all outward indications, he's a normal happy child, but if you talk to him, you will soon realize he has some psychological problems.
-
3.
Tending to the exterior or outside.
-
4.
Foreign; not civil or intestine.
